I plan to start a full bolt on this spring. Later a full build. With that in mind what mods do I want for my full bolt on and what do I do first,second, and so on. Keep in mind I am your average guy and don't have thousands to blow at a time, this will be a summer long deal. I have a 95 camaro lt1 A4.
My thoughts are.
1) CAI.
2) Free mods
3) Hooker long tubes.
4) True duals with x pipe and Spintechs.
5) 3500 stall
6) 3.73 ears
7) Shift kit
8) Torque arm
9) Sub Frame connectors
10) Electric water pump
11) Intake Elbow
12) 58 mm Throttle Body
13) Ported intake
14) Mail order tune.
What else am I lacking or how should I rearrange the order of install.
15) maybe 100 shot.
Then
16) 12 bolt moser rear
17) Heads and cam. Maybe LE2 or 3 combo.
Then
18) Fully forged 383 build.

I would do the mail order tune when your done with mods? That wayt you dont have to get it tuned twice...unless you only plan on doing so much this year and do the other next year?

I would do Stall/Shift Kit before Gears b/c an Automatic isn't anything at all without a Stall trust me you will love it. Don't waste your money on an Intake Elbow, TB, or Ported Intake, won't do squat on a bolt-on car. I wouldn't bother with a TB or Manifold Porting until your at the Heads/Cam level. I would add LCA's to that list.

hmm yo ucould go with a 58mm throttle body but thats way to much for your setup unless your running an LE3 or forced induction. and with that itll give you the cost of that ~$300 and put it towards your exhaust which i would put up first along with a CAI for performance mods. thats what i did and am very happy. just dont forget you could burn up your O2's with coated headers
